I usually don't get pissed at games but there are a few exceptions (Demon's Souls....). I usually take a break, or switch to a different game for a little. For example, the other day I was playing Uncharted 2 trying to get past Chapter 22 on Hard, and was getting destroyed. So I stopped and quit at the checkpoint, and played Everyday Shooter for a little (that game always calms me down). When I felt better and not so stressed, I switched back over to give it another shot.
So just do something for half an hour that relaxes you. Read a book, play a casual game, come on Gamespot, whatever helps you. Then get back on and try again :)
